Key Features to Look For
When you’re shopping for a golf club set, several features make a big difference.
- Club Count: Most beginner sets come with 10-14 clubs. This is usually enough to cover all your needs on the course. You’ll typically find a driver, fairway woods, hybrids, irons (usually 5-iron through pitching wedge), and a putter.
- Driver Loft: A higher loft (around 10.5 degrees) on your driver helps you get the ball in the air more easily. This is great for beginners who might not swing as fast.
- Iron Forgiveness: Look for irons with larger clubheads and a “cavity back” design. These features help you hit the ball straighter even if you don’t hit it perfectly in the center.
- Hybrid Clubs: Hybrids are a mix between a wood and an iron. They are easier to hit than long irons and are a valuable addition to any beginner set.
- Putter Style: Putters come in different shapes. Blade putters and mallet putters are common. Try a few to see which one feels best in your hands.
Important Materials
The materials used in golf clubs affect how they perform and how durable they are.
- Shaft Material: Most beginner sets use graphite shafts. Graphite is lighter than steel, which helps you swing faster and generate more clubhead speed. This can lead to longer shots. Some irons might have steel shafts, which offer more control for some players.
- Clubhead Material: Clubheads are often made from stainless steel or titanium. Titanium is lighter and stronger, which allows for larger, more forgiving clubheads. Stainless steel is durable and more affordable.
- Grip Material: Rubber is the most common material for grips. Good grips provide comfort and prevent your hands from slipping, even in wet conditions.
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Several things can make a golf club set better or not as good.
- Brand Reputation: Well-known golf brands often invest more in research and development. This can lead to better-designed and higher-performing clubs. However, you can still find great value from less famous brands.
- Forgiveness Technology: Clubs designed with forgiveness in mind help golfers who don’t always hit the ball perfectly. Features like wider soles on irons and perimeter weighting in drivers improve these clubs.
- Build Quality: Look for clubs that feel solid and well-made. Avoid sets that feel flimsy or have parts that seem cheaply attached.
- Customization Options: While less common in sets under $1000, some sets might offer choices for shaft flex or grip size. This can improve how the clubs fit you.
